Add JSF capabilities asks a lot of questions and uses *absolute* filepaths
--------------------------------------------------------------------------

                 Key: JBIDE-5901
                 URL: https://jira.jboss.org/jira/browse/JBIDE-5901
             Project: Tools (JBoss Tools)
          Issue Type: Bug
          Components: JSF
    Affects Versions: 3.1.0.CR1
            Reporter: Max Rydahl Andersen
             Fix For: 3.1.1, 3.2.next


When Adding JSF support to an existing project i'm asked about *alot* of questions which seems irrelevant/outofdate plus it lists absolute file names.

Web Root is fair to ask about, but why the full path ?

Source and classes folder should be a given when its a Java Project anyway ?

lib folder ? no idea what that is.
